So, how does one go about getting a DNA test? The process is relatively simple and can be done from the comfort of your own home There are many companies that offer DNA testing kits, which typically involve providing a saliva sample in a tube or swabbing the inside of your cheek Once you have collected your sample, you can send it back to the company for analysis getting a dna test. The turnaround time for results can vary depending on the company, but you can usually expect to receive your results within a few weeks.

After receiving your results, you will be able to access a detailed report that outlines your ancestry composition, genetic traits, and health information This report can be a valuable resource for understanding your genetic makeup and making informed decisions about your health Some DNA testing companies also offer additional services, such as connecting you with genetic counselors or providing ongoing support and information about your results.

It’s important to note that there are different types of DNA tests available, each with its own unique benefits and limitations The most common types of DNA tests include autosomal DNA testing, Y-DNA testing, and mtDNA testing Autosomal DNA testing is the most popular type of test and analyzes genetic information from both sides of your family, providing a broad overview of your ancestry and health Y-DNA testing focuses on the Y chromosome and can trace your paternal line, while mtDNA testing examines the mitochondrial DNA and can trace your maternal line.
